Overview

This article explains the reason for the following error message when exporting an NCM rule to MS Excel:

String values assigned to a cell cannot have a length greater than 32767.

Product section

Network Configuration Manager

Resolution

Based on the Microsoft document - (© 2022  Microsoft, available at Excel specifications and limits, obtained on 2022), the total number of characters that a cell can contain is 32,767 characters.
